pg&e pled not guilty to new charges that came out of the san bruno pipeline explosion. the utility faces record fines if convicted. >> vic lee joins us in the newsroom with the dwementd developed today. >> about three weeks ago, the u.s. attorney issued a superseding or new indictment against pg&e which more than doubled the criminal charges. none of the executives showed up for the arraign mentd, but after prosecutors read the indictment, an attorney for pg&e responded not guilty to all charges. >> pg skn e faces one count of obstructed the federal investigation into the pipeline explosion and 23 counts of violating the safety act. it killed eight people and injured 66 others. 38 homes were destroyed, 17 others badly damaged. if federal prosecutors have their way, the giant utility could be slapped with a $1.3 billion fine. pg&e maintains it did nothing wrong. >> no pg&e employee intentionally violated any laws. when any errors are made, employees are acting in good faith. >> some disagree. >> we believe it's high time pg&e cleaned up its act, that it understood and to

. >>> a lawsuit filed by pg&e shareholders over the san bruno pipeline explosion will be allowed to moveorward. that's after a san mateo superior court judge lifted a stay that was put in place while the utility reached settlements in more than 200 civil lawsuits filed by victim's families. eight people were killed. more than 66 people were hurt in the 2010 explosion that leveled 38 homes. the lawsuit accuses pg&e of violating pipeline safety regulations and trying to block a government investigation into the blast. >>> pg&e says it has made major safety improvements in the wake of the san bruno explosion including technology that can instantly pinpoint gas leaks. the utility says it is now able to monitor conditions in realtime using helicopters, ground crews and vehicles equipped with sensors that can rapidly detect leaks. pg&e says that technology could be especially important after an earthquake or even heavy rain. >> it's a thousand times more sensitive than traditional legacy equipment. it's much faster. finds a lot more leaks about 80% more leaks. >> however, pg&e could still be f
